Uh, somebody is not meeting their iPhone sales numbers. T-Mobile announced a Spring sale for the Apple iPhone, which features the 8GB iPhone at only 99 Euro (~$155) - The normal price is 399 Euro!
Nothing comes for free of course. You only get the 99 Euro iPhone if you pick the highest plan, which is 89 Euro/month (~$140). Still, for power users, that is the plan you'd want anyway.
With lower plans the iPhone price is also reduced significantely. This dramatic price cuts will surely push lots of consumers over the edge to get their hands on the iPhone in Germany.
The iPhone promotion starts on April 7th and lasts until June 30th.
The 16GB iPhone still sells at the normal price of 499 Euro.
Via this T-Mobile press-release (German).
If AT&T is up for a similar promotion is unkown. Of course such a sale always feeds the hope that Apple will be updating the iPhone to feature 3G soon.
